Our server costs ~$56 per month to run. Please consider donating or becoming a Patron to help keep the site running. Help us gain new members by following us on Twitter and liking our page on Facebook!
Current time: August 6, 2025, 11:55 am

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Dear Theists
#44
RE: Dear Theists
(April 16, 2015 at 2:15 pm)Faith No More Wrote:
(April 15, 2015 at 9:41 pm)Mezmo! Wrote: You're an idiot. Trilobites had functional reproductive organs and I don't see many of those around.

You only think I'm an idiot because your mind is too simple to understand anything but goddidit.

Dinosaurs had functioning sexual organs but I don't see any of them, either.  Do you honestly think you're making valid objections to evolution?  

Ready, fire, aim. I fully support evolutionary theory. I have no idea what you're going on about. 

You specifically said that all evolution requires is functional reproductive organs. It isn't enough to just have reproductive organs; a species must also have adaptations that allow them to use those reproductive organs and produce viable offspring. In my example, trilobites had reproductive organs, but lacked other features that would have preserved their reproductive advantage. 

(April 16, 2015 at 2:15 pm)Faith No More Wrote: Oh, please do enlighten us and tell us about how believing in angels and demons running around isn't delusional.

Delusional thinking is the result of biologically based mental illness. Specific beliefs do not come from any biological deficiency. Religious beliefs, like any other belief, can be wrong or ill-logical without being the product of mental illness.
Reply



Messages In This Thread
Dear Theists - by Silver - April 14, 2015 at 11:10 pm
RE: Dear Theists - by Chad32 - April 14, 2015 at 11:16 pm
RE: Dear Theists - by Silver - April 14, 2015 at 11:18 pm
RE: Dear Theists - by dyresand - April 14, 2015 at 11:21 pm
RE: Dear Theists - by Silver - April 14, 2015 at 11:24 pm
RE: Dear Theists - by dyresand - April 14, 2015 at 11:26 pm
RE: Dear Theists - by Silver - April 14, 2015 at 11:28 pm
RE: Dear Theists - by Chad32 - April 14, 2015 at 11:42 pm
RE: Dear Theists - by Pizza - April 15, 2015 at 12:39 am
RE: Dear Theists - by Silver - April 15, 2015 at 12:41 am
RE: Dear Theists - by Minimalist - April 15, 2015 at 12:46 am
RE: Dear Theists - by MysticKnight - April 15, 2015 at 12:47 am
RE: Dear Theists - by Silver - April 15, 2015 at 12:51 am
RE: Dear Theists - by MysticKnight - April 15, 2015 at 1:00 am
RE: Dear Theists - by Silver - April 15, 2015 at 1:07 am
RE: Dear Theists - by Exian - April 15, 2015 at 1:20 am
RE: Dear Theists - by Silver - April 15, 2015 at 1:21 am
RE: Dear Theists - by MysticKnight - April 15, 2015 at 2:38 pm
RE: Dear Theists - by Neo-Scholastic - April 15, 2015 at 8:36 pm
RE: Dear Theists - by IATIA - April 15, 2015 at 8:43 pm
RE: Dear Theists - by Faith No More - April 15, 2015 at 9:01 pm
RE: Dear Theists - by Neo-Scholastic - April 15, 2015 at 9:41 pm
RE: Dear Theists - by KevinM1 - April 15, 2015 at 9:49 pm
RE: Dear Theists - by IATIA - April 15, 2015 at 10:18 pm
RE: Dear Theists - by Thumpalumpacus - April 16, 2015 at 9:57 am
RE: Dear Theists - by Faith No More - April 16, 2015 at 2:15 pm
RE: Dear Theists - by Neo-Scholastic - April 16, 2015 at 4:41 pm
RE: Dear Theists - by Faith No More - April 16, 2015 at 10:22 pm
RE: Dear Theists - by Godschild - April 16, 2015 at 10:37 pm
RE: Dear Theists - by IATIA - April 16, 2015 at 10:41 pm
RE: Dear Theists - by Godschild - April 16, 2015 at 11:31 pm
RE: Dear Theists - by Faith No More - April 16, 2015 at 10:45 pm
RE: Dear Theists - by Godschild - April 16, 2015 at 11:33 pm
RE: Dear Theists - by Thumpalumpacus - April 17, 2015 at 11:36 am
RE: Dear Theists - by Thumpalumpacus - April 15, 2015 at 9:16 pm
RE: Dear Theists - by Spooky - April 18, 2015 at 12:23 pm
RE: Dear Theists - by Minimalist - April 15, 2015 at 2:55 pm
RE: Dear Theists - by IATIA - April 15, 2015 at 8:12 pm
RE: Dear Theists - by robvalue - April 15, 2015 at 3:02 pm
Dear Theists - by TubbyTubby - April 15, 2015 at 3:02 pm
RE: Dear Theists - by Polaris - April 15, 2015 at 7:11 pm
RE: Dear Theists - by Clueless Morgan - April 15, 2015 at 7:49 pm
RE: Dear Theists - by Whateverist - April 15, 2015 at 8:05 pm
RE: Dear Theists - by Whateverist - April 15, 2015 at 8:49 pm
RE: Dear Theists - by Whateverist - April 15, 2015 at 9:42 pm
RE: Dear Theists - by Godschild - April 16, 2015 at 12:59 am
RE: Dear Theists - by Mudhammam - April 16, 2015 at 1:33 am
RE: Dear Theists - by Minimalist - April 16, 2015 at 1:38 am
RE: Dear Theists - by Aractus - April 16, 2015 at 2:52 am
RE: Dear Theists - by Neo-Scholastic - April 16, 2015 at 9:35 am
RE: Dear Theists - by Lek - April 16, 2015 at 11:40 am
RE: Dear Theists - by dyresand - April 16, 2015 at 5:53 pm
RE: Dear Theists - by Neo-Scholastic - April 16, 2015 at 6:55 pm
RE: Dear Theists - by robvalue - April 16, 2015 at 1:47 pm
RE: Dear Theists - by The Grand Nudger - April 16, 2015 at 5:03 pm
RE: Dear Theists - by Neo-Scholastic - April 16, 2015 at 5:12 pm
RE: Dear Theists - by The Grand Nudger - April 16, 2015 at 6:59 pm
RE: Dear Theists - by Polaris - April 16, 2015 at 10:27 pm
RE: Dear Theists - by Mudhammam - April 16, 2015 at 11:52 pm
RE: Dear Theists - by Polaris - April 17, 2015 at 8:45 pm
RE: Dear Theists - by The Grand Nudger - April 16, 2015 at 11:32 pm
RE: Dear Theists - by Silver - April 16, 2015 at 11:32 pm
RE: Dear Theists - by The Grand Nudger - April 16, 2015 at 11:35 pm
RE: Dear Theists - by Godschild - April 18, 2015 at 12:18 am
RE: Dear Theists - by Whateverist - April 18, 2015 at 6:02 am
RE: Dear Theists - by Neo-Scholastic - April 17, 2015 at 9:14 am
RE: Dear Theists - by dyresand - April 17, 2015 at 9:34 am
RE: Dear Theists - by Neo-Scholastic - April 17, 2015 at 8:54 pm
RE: Dear Theists - by Polaris - April 17, 2015 at 9:05 pm
RE: Dear Theists - by dyresand - April 17, 2015 at 9:13 pm
RE: Dear Theists - by downbeatplumb - April 18, 2015 at 7:18 am
RE: Dear Theists - by Whateverist - April 18, 2015 at 11:42 am
RE: Dear Theists - by Neo-Scholastic - September 25, 2015 at 10:53 am
RE: Dear Theists - by downbeatplumb - September 25, 2015 at 11:20 am
RE: Dear Theists - by Thumpalumpacus - April 18, 2015 at 12:22 am
RE: Dear Theists - by Ronkonkoma - September 24, 2015 at 2:33 am
RE: Dear Theists - by TheRocketSurgeon - September 24, 2015 at 3:06 am
RE: Dear Theists - by Ronkonkoma - September 25, 2015 at 2:22 am
RE: Dear Theists - by Ronkonkoma - September 25, 2015 at 2:24 am
RE: Dear Theists - by Ronkonkoma - September 25, 2015 at 2:25 am

Possibly Related Threads...
Thread Author Replies Views Last Post
  Dear God, please soften their hearts... zwanzig 12 2364 August 6, 2023 at 3:31 pm
Last Post: LinuxGal
  Dear Xristards Don't Pick On Muslims Minimalist 20 3833 July 24, 2017 at 1:40 pm
Last Post: Cecelia
  Dear Atheists ParagonLost 111 22791 December 1, 2016 at 12:49 am
Last Post: GOĐ
  Dear god dyresand 14 2738 May 3, 2016 at 8:37 pm
Last Post: dyresand
  Dear Satan dyresand 9 3372 April 30, 2016 at 7:33 pm
Last Post: dyresand
  Dear christians... dyresand 1 1376 April 2, 2016 at 4:02 am
Last Post: Wyrd of Gawd
Question Dear Christians: What does your god actually do? Aractus 144 62577 October 9, 2015 at 6:38 am
Last Post: robvalue
  Dear Christians Phatt Matt s 70 17936 April 4, 2014 at 8:25 pm
Last Post: Phatt Matt s
  Oh Dear...Whatever Will They Do in Oklahoma? Minimalist 20 8339 March 17, 2014 at 1:31 pm
Last Post: Doubting Thomas
  Dear Christians... Are you F***ing serious? Proof of Blood and Ark xr34p3rx 29 17891 January 12, 2014 at 2:26 pm
Last Post: xr34p3rx



Users browsing this thread: 1 Guest(s)